Skiing Wraps Up 2024 Harvard Carnival, Drolet Wins 7.5k Skate

CRAFTSBURY, Vt. and BURKE, Vt. – Senior Rémi Drolet won the men's 7.5k skate, junior Matt Ryan came in 10th in the men's slalom, senior Elsie Halvorsen placed 12th in the women's 7.5k skate, and junior Quincy Donley finished 20th in the women's 7.5k skate as Harvard University skiing wrapped up competition on day two of the Harvard Carnival on Saturday.
 
In the opening day of alpine competition at Burke Mountain after Friday's action was postponed, Ryan (10th) and Halvorsen (12th) paced four Crimson with top-30 finishes on the day.
 
On the second day of action of nordic events at the Craftsbury Outdoor Center, Drolet completed a weekend sweep after he also took the men's 15k classic mass start on Friday. Donley closed the weekend with a pair of top-20 finishes.  

Harvard Highlights: Alpine

  • Junior Matt Ryan led the Crimson with a 10th-place finish in men's slalom, posting a total time of 1:26.71 with 30 EISA points and 26 NCAA points. His day included a sixth-place finish in run one.
  • Senior Elsie Halvorsen placed 12th in women's slalom and posted her third top-30 finish in as many races to open the year. She posted a total time of 1:32.30, 29 EISA points, and 22 NCAA points.
  • Sophomore Luke Kearing came in 22nd place in 1:27.67 for 19 EISA points and nine NCAA points.
  • Senior Liam McNamara placed 24th and has finished in the top-30 in all three races this season. He moved up with his second run, finishing with a total time of 1:28.56 for 17 EISA points and seven NCAA points.
  • As a team, the men came in sixth with 66 points.
  • Alpine's giant slalom event, originally scheduled for Friday at Burke Mountain, was postponed due to weather conditions.
 

Harvard Highlights: Nordic Day 2

  • Senior Rémi Drolet captured the men's 7.5k skate with a time of 16:02, completing a weekend sweep of first-place finishes. He totaled 50 EISA points and 100 NCAA points for the second straight day. Drolet has placed in the top three at all six races this carnival season.
  • Junior Quincy Donley paced the women's team with a 20th-place finish in the 7.5k skate with a time of 19:33, collecting 23 EISA points and 11 NCAA points. She placed in the top-20 in both events on the weekend.
  • First-year Sam Gallaudet came in 27th in the men's race with a time of 17:30, notching 18 EISA points and four NCAA points.
  • Sophomore Hayden McJunkin tallied a 33rd-place finish in 20:08, tallying 19 EISA points and two NCAA points while Breagh Bridge came in 38th in 20:26 for 17 EISA points.
  • Senior Laura Appleby (43rd, 20:32) and first-year Clara Lake (49th, 20:38) also finished in the top 50.
  • The men's team came in fifth on day two with 75 points while the women's side placed seventh on day two with 59 points.

Harvard's alpine team will close out the UVM Carnival tomorrow – Sunday, Feb. 4 – at Burke and Feb. 8 at the Dartmouth Skiway before both teams compete at the Dartmouth Carnival from Feb. 9-10 with alpine events taking place at the Dartmouth Skiway in Lyme Center, New Hampshire and nordic competition occurring at Oak Hill in Hanover, New Hampshire.
